Thermoelectric, Peltier Modules are modules that are used to effectively transfer heat from one source to another. They use a process known as the Peltier effect, which is when a voltage applied across a junction of two different conductors results in heat being absorbed at one junction and released in the other. This heat transfer is used in a variety of applications including cooling and heating applications. The OT1.2-7-F1A Peltier Module works to transfer heat under controlled conditions. It is composed of a p-type and n-type semiconductor material. When a voltage is applied to the Peltier Module, current passes across it and causes the electrons/holes to move from one side of the material to the other. This creates a temperature gradient along the junction, leading to a transfer of heat from one side to the other, resulting in one side being cooled while the other being heated.

This type of Peltier Module can be used for many different applications. It can be used as a cooling system for commercial and industrial products, such as computers, medical devices, and more. It is also commonly used in cryogenics and heat pumps for temperature control.
